How to Conduct Regular Security Audits for Data Protection

Conducting regular security audits is a critical practice for ensuring robust data protection. This article delves into the methodologies, tools, and best practices for performing effective security audits to safeguard sensitive information.

Understanding the Importance of Security Audits

Security audits are systematic evaluations of an organization’s information system, measuring how well it conforms to a set of established criteria. These audits are essential for identifying vulnerabilities, ensuring compliance with regulations, and maintaining the integrity and confidentiality of data.

Why Security Audits Matter

Security audits play a pivotal role in an organization’s overall security strategy. They help in:

  • Identifying Vulnerabilities: Regular audits can uncover weaknesses in the system that could be exploited by malicious actors.
  • Ensuring Compliance: Many industries are subject to stringent regulations regarding data protection. Audits ensure that the organization complies with these legal requirements.
  • Maintaining Trust: Clients and stakeholders need assurance that their data is secure. Regular audits help build and maintain this trust.
  • Improving Security Posture: By identifying and addressing vulnerabilities, organizations can continuously improve their security measures.

Steps to Conduct a Security Audit

Conducting a security audit involves several key steps, each crucial for a comprehensive evaluation of the organization’s security posture.

1. Define the Scope

The first step in conducting a security audit is to define its scope. This involves identifying the systems, networks, and data that will be evaluated. The scope should be comprehensive enough to cover all critical areas but focused enough to be manageable.

2. Gather Information

Once the scope is defined, the next step is to gather information about the systems and processes in place. This can include:

  • Network diagrams
  • System configurations
  • Access control lists
  • Previous audit reports

This information provides a baseline for the audit and helps identify areas that require closer examination.

3. Assess Risks

Risk assessment is a critical component of the security audit process. This involves identifying potential threats and vulnerabilities and evaluating their impact on the organization. Common risk assessment techniques include:

  • Threat modeling
  • Vulnerability scanning
  • Penetration testing

These techniques help prioritize the risks and focus the audit on the most critical areas.

4. Evaluate Controls

After assessing the risks, the next step is to evaluate the existing security controls. This involves reviewing policies, procedures, and technical measures to determine their effectiveness in mitigating identified risks. Key areas to evaluate include:

  • Access controls
  • Data encryption
  • Incident response plans
  • Security awareness training

Evaluating these controls helps identify gaps and areas for improvement.

5. Document Findings

Once the evaluation is complete, the findings should be documented in a detailed report. This report should include:

  • A summary of the audit scope and objectives
  • Detailed findings, including identified vulnerabilities and risks
  • Recommendations for mitigating identified risks
  • An action plan for implementing the recommendations

The report serves as a valuable resource for improving the organization’s security posture.

6. Implement Recommendations

The final step in the security audit process is to implement the recommendations outlined in the audit report. This involves:

  • Prioritizing the recommendations based on risk
  • Developing a timeline for implementation
  • Assigning responsibilities for each action item
  • Monitoring progress and ensuring timely completion

Implementing the recommendations helps address identified vulnerabilities and improve the overall security of the organization.

Best Practices for Effective Security Audits

To ensure the effectiveness of security audits, organizations should follow several best practices.

1. Conduct Audits Regularly

Security audits should be conducted regularly to ensure continuous improvement. The frequency of audits can vary based on the organization’s size, industry, and risk profile, but annual audits are generally recommended.

2. Use a Risk-Based Approach

Focusing on the most critical risks ensures that the audit addresses the areas that pose the greatest threat to the organization. This risk-based approach helps prioritize resources and efforts effectively.

3. Involve Key Stakeholders

Involving key stakeholders, including IT, security, and business leaders, ensures that the audit is comprehensive and aligned with organizational objectives. Stakeholder involvement also helps secure buy-in for implementing recommendations.

4. Leverage Automated Tools

Automated tools can streamline the audit process and improve accuracy. Tools for vulnerability scanning, configuration management, and log analysis can help identify issues more efficiently and provide valuable insights.

5. Maintain Documentation

Maintaining thorough documentation of the audit process, findings, and actions taken is essential for accountability and future reference. Documentation also helps demonstrate compliance with regulatory requirements.

Conclusion

Conducting regular security audits is a vital practice for protecting sensitive data and maintaining a strong security posture. By following a structured approach and adhering to best practices, organizations can effectively identify and mitigate risks, ensure compliance, and build trust with stakeholders. Regular audits not only help in uncovering vulnerabilities but also provide a roadmap for continuous improvement in data security.